Hey guys - I need some habanero's for some jerk Chicken and the only thing the grocery had was packs. I needed 3, got 15. Can you freeze these babies?
 
Yes, they freeze nicely. You don't even have to blanch them.
 
I buy large bags of jalopy (jalapeno) peppers all the time and I freeze them two ways; I cut the tops off all of them, then I slice half of them for burgers, sandwiches, etc. and I split the other half open, remove the seeds and ribs, and thinly slice theminto strips to add flavour to my cooking with not so much heat.
